The young art room (Avda. De América, 13) presents the exhibition ‘The iguanas are going to bite the men who do not dream’one of the winning projects of the XVI Edition of the National Team ‘is sought commissioner’, which is committed to new models … curatorial, facilitating access to the professional world of young commissioners.

The works that compose it, in charge of five artists and mostly sculptural facilitiesthey refer, thanks to the hidden symbology of their materials, to myth or folklore, “to offer us a resistance to the current order of things, positioning both critically and in the quality of new organizing forms of the world.”
On the ground floor, the artist Mónica Mays With its piece ‘ornamental Without Value’ presents a large sculpture as a mastodontic, report and primitive icon. «If we pay special attention, we will see that this has been built, among other remains, with palm leaves. The unusable waste, with hardly any economic value, that our society discards after the extraction of its blood, the oil, which functions as an industry engine ».
WEIXIN QUK CHONG It is inspired by the funeral rituals of the Han dynasty for its installation ‘Immortaly Masks’ recovering the lost memory of deities and cult figures placing them in a society where the show, pleasure and liquid corporality give us new idols, more confusing and less Stable, but that seem to establish a more direct speech to our closest needs. Sandra Valin its installation ‘Agón’ resorts to the Egyptian game of ‘dogs and jackals’ to tell us about architectural constructions as a means of limiting and understanding the world, and, in turn, to nature and our relationship with it.
On the upper floor of the exhibition, the artist Emmanuela Soria Ruiz It presents ‘Fire and Fuga’, two textile pieces that point to a feminist and post-humanist reading of the myth of the daughters of MINIAS in the ‘Metamorphosis of Ovid’: These textile sculptures-cortinins that suggest both concealment and transit-capture a moment of rupture: the flight and disaster prior to the metamorphosis of the sisters in bats, and invites you to think about the relationship between body, materiality and mutation, and disasters that precede all metamorphosis.

The call ‘is sought commissioner’ is an initiative of the Community of Madrid that bets on the visibility of emerging creation and talent of young creators, and facilitates access to the professional world to commissioners under 35 years to develop their projects in the Young art room. Since its inception in 2009, about 50 of these professionals and more than 140 artists have benefited from this proposal that is part of the aid and scholarship program to the emerging visual arts of the Ministry of Culture, Tourism and Sports.
A line of work that materializes in the promotion of the creation and training of these new artists and commissioners, which also includes the photolibro project <40 or the call for plastic arts circuits, among others.
